Now that spring is in full swing, The Gardens at Arkanshire Senior Living is alive with color, fragrance, and fresh air. This vibrant season inspires connection, movement, and meaningful time outdoors for residents and families alike.
To prepare for the season, our team refreshes the front entry, replaces seat cushions, and refills our signature Arkansas rock waterfall, framed by lush, mature English Ivy. We also begin tending our expansive garden, which boasts hundreds of flowers and vegetables. These harvests provide fresh ingredients for our culinary team throughout the season.
Residents play an active role in shaping our gardens. Led by Resident Master Gardener Alice H., they spend the winter planning what to plant each spring. As a registered Monarch Butterfly Waystation, our community also selects butterfly-friendly plants to support pollinators and bring joy to those who visit the gardens.
Spring brings a full calendar of outdoor events. Favorites include garden BBQs and ice cream socials. This year, we plan to enhance our outdoor amenities with the addition of a pergola or gazebo, and we’re also considering a shuffleboard court to increase resident engagement and comfort. Easter and Mother’s Day bring even more joy as families gather to celebrate in the sunshine.
A well-maintained outdoor environment offers more than beauty. It creates a peaceful, sensory-rich space that encourages gardening, relaxation, and conversation. With each bloom and every butterfly, residents feel more connected to nature and each other.
As April unfolds, these thoughtful touches reflect our ongoing commitment to creating vibrant, engaging spaces where residents can thrive. Whether gardening, entertaining, or simply enjoying the view, spring at Arkanshire is a season to savor.
